Abello, Espina impresibo sa PSC-Visayas Amateur boxing

GIPOSTE sa mga boksidor sa Joeric boxing stable nga sila si Sean Abello ug Kenneth Espina ang labing impresibong kadaugan sa matag buwan nga Philippine Sports Commission (PSC) Visayas amateur boxing event kagahapon sa Cebu City Sports Center boxing gym.

Si Abello mirehistro og 1st round referee stop contest (RSC) nga kadaugan batok kang Nathaniel Alfornon sa 10,000 BC stable sa mosquitoweight division (35 kgs.) nga away. Samtang si Espina miposte sab og 1st round RSC (1:46) nga kadaugan batok kang Justine Equilla sa Rex Wakee Salud (RWS) stable sa light pinweight division (44kgs).

Mao usab sila si Kevin Sumalinog sa SEVA stable ug Manolito Esdamen sa RWS stable.

Si Sumalinog nimugna og 2nd round RSC batok kang Wildfred Dibdib (48 kgs.) samtang si Esdamen midaog batok kang Denviel Patillano sa 2nd round sa flyweight category (50 kgs).

Ningposte og unanimous decision nga kadaugan mao sila si David Mancao batok Prence Espina, Bryan Baricuatro batok Jesreel Quilaton, Daryl Balderas batok Arniel Fajardo , John Jimenez batok JM Andrejas, Tricia Marie Llamas batok Patricia Sumalinog.

Ang kompetisyon gidumala ni Amateur Boxing Alliances of the Philippines (Abap) Central Visayas head ug PSC coordinator Lorenzo “Chao” Sy. (ESL)
